Houston Half Marathon

Yep, finished my first Half Marathon yesterday. Gorgeous day, perfect running weather, having a blast ... until just about mile 9 - right knee, IT band. Now I know just what sports athletes mean when they talk about being frustrated by injury. I could barely walk. I managed to make it to the medical tent about .5 miles away, had them tape the leg just above the knee to compress the band a bit and then somehow hobbled my way to the finish line.

There was no way I was not going to finish after waking up at 5 a.m. on Saturday mornings for the past couple of months to train :-)

See you out there next year and many, many thanks to all of you that were out there cheering!!!
